Modern reel design had actually begun in England during the last component of the 18th century, and the predominant version in usage was understood as the 'Nottingham reel'. The reel was a broad drum that spooled out freely and was excellent for permitting the bait to wander a lengthy way out with the existing.


The product used for the pole itself altered from the heavy timbers belonging to England to lighter and extra flexible varieties imported from abroad, specifically from South America and the West Indies (Salmon Fishing Guide). Bamboo poles ended up being the generally favoured alternative from the mid 19th century, and several strips of the product were cut from the walking cane, milled right into shape, and afterwards glued with each other to develop the light, solid, hexagonal rods with a strong core that transcended to anything that preceded them


Angling became a prominent recreational activity in the 19th century. Publish from Currier and Ives. Tackle design started to boost from the 1880s. The introduction of new timbers to the manufacture of fly rods made it feasible to cast flies into the wind on silk lines, as opposed to steed hair.

These very early fly lines proved problematic as they had actually to be covered with numerous dressings to make them drift and required to be taken off the reel and dried every four hours or so to avoid them from ending up being waterlogged. Another negative consequence was that it became easy for the a lot longer line to obtain right into a tangle this was called a 'tangle' in Britain, and a 'reaction' in the US.

The American, Charles F. Orvis, made and distributed a novel reel and fly layout in 1874, described by reel historian Jim Brown as the "standard of American reel design," and the very first totally modern fly reel. Albert Illingworth, 1st Baron Illingworth a textiles mogul, patented the modern type of fixed-spool spinning frame in 1905.


Because the line did not have to draw versus a rotating spool, much lighter attractions can be cast than with conventional reels. The advancement of cost-effective fiberglass rods, synthetic fly lines, and monofilament my latest blog post leaders in the very early 1950s revitalized the appeal of fly fishing. A man casting an attraction and rotating the draw in Kanagawa, Japan.Entertainment, commercial and artisanal fishers use different methods, and likewise, occasionally, the very same techniques. Recreational fishers fish for pleasure, sport, or to offer food for themselves, while industrial fishers fish for profit. Artisanal fishers use conventional, low-tech techniques, for survival in third-world nations, and as a social heritage in various other countries.

A fishing vessel is a watercraft or ship utilized to catch fish in the sea, or on a lake or river., in 2004 there were 4 million industrial fishing vessels.


Nearly all of these outdoor decked vessels are mechanised, and 40,000 of them are over 100 lots.


Unlike most industrial angling vessels, entertainment fishing boats are usually not dedicated just to angling.
